Output e5637885c120748ddcf30279b1e6ca8c16df42a10b1472b4d1a1a7079ee2a23c:96

value
105546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 12799477c3fabb69b9f865dfba3c27a6eed4b88d0d1544122146619b6fb2981e
address
bc1pzfuega7rl2aknw0cvh0m50p85mhdfwydp525gy3pgesekmajnq0q36elkm
transaction
e5637885c120748ddcf30279b1e6ca8c16df42a10b1472b4d1a1a7079ee2a23c
spent
true